Book Description

The First Year November 8, 2005
Prostate cancer is the most commonly diagnosed cancer in American men—about 1 in 6 will be diagnosed in his lifetime—but fortunately it is also one of the most treatable cancers. From the first moment of his diagnosis, author Christopher Lukas took charge and educated himself on every aspect of his condition. Now, as a "patient-expert," he guides those newly diagnosed step-by-step through their first year with prostate cancer. Lukas provides crucial information about the nature of the disease, treatment options, diet, exercise, social concerns, emotional issues, networking with others, and much more. The First Year®-Prostate Cancer will be an essential resource for everyone who wants to be an informed, active participant in the management of their condition.

I had an excellent Urologist. He prepared me well for the surgery and afterwards, but as I was in the middle of recovery a number of other questions arose. Rather than call the office every day with the next question, I ordered this book and read it. I had a lot of time during recovery to think about a number of things. This form of cancer is easy to live through if you approach it the right way. The one area I did not anticipate was post operative depression. This book got me through that - thanks!
